What’s Rack and Pinion, Anyway?

Before we get into the costs, let’s quickly cover what rack and pinion is. The rack and pinion is a critical component of your vehicle’s steering system. It converts the rotational motion of the steering wheel into linear motion, allowing your car to turn smoothly and effortlessly. However, over time, wear and tear can cause the rack and pinion to degrade, leading to loose steering, uneven tire wear, and other issues.

Symptoms of a Faulty Rack and Pinion

So, how do you know if your rack and pinion needs attention? Here are some common symptoms:

  • Loose or vague steering
  • Steering wheel vibration
  • Squealing or grinding noises when turning
  • Uneven tire wear

How Much Does it Cost to Repair Rack and Pinion: Labor Costs

When it comes to repairing or replacing the rack and pinion, labor costs can vary widely depending on the mechanic, location, and make of your vehicle. Here are some estimated labor costs:

  • Average labor cost for rack and pinion repair: $50-$150 per hour
  • Average labor cost for rack and pinion replacement: $200-$500

Assuming a 2-5 hour repair job, the total labor cost would be:

  • Rack and pinion repair: $100-$750
  • Rack and pinion replacement: $400-$2,500

How Much Does it Cost to Repair Rack and Pinion: Parts Costs

Now, let’s talk about parts costs. The cost of a new rack and pinion can vary depending on the make and model of your vehicle. Here are some estimated parts costs:

  • O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er) rack and pinion: $200-$1,000
  • Aftermarket rack and pinion: $100-$500
  • Rebuilt or refurbished rack and pinion: $150-$700

Factors Affecting the Cost of Rack and Pinion Repair

Several factors can affect the cost of rack and pinion repair, including:

  • Make and model of your vehicle
  • Type of repair needed (e.g., repair vs. replacement)
  • Mechanic’s expertise and rates
  • Location (urban vs. rural)

DIY Rack and Pinion Repair: Is it Worth it?

If you’re feeling handy and want to save some cash, you might be wondering if DIY rack and pinion repair is worth it. While it’s possible to do the repair yourself, it’s essential to consider the following factors:

  • Your level of mechanical expertise
  • The complexity of the repair job
  • The cost of specialized tools and equipment
  • The potential risks of incorrect installation

If you’re not confident in your abilities or don’t have experience with rack and pinion repairs, it’s best to leave it to a professional.
